Can you tell what sort of books I like to read??? This card should give you a hint...lol. Yes, I'm hooked on mysteries! My favorites are probably Scandinavian mysteries (Swedish, Norwegian, Finnish, Icelandic...)..not sure why they are so interesting but I love 'em! I did the checkerboard flooring technique and added a printed out bg from an Edward Gorey site. The suspects on this are from the artist Edward Gorey...I have a few stamps with his images. They're pretty cool. I added the ribbon as a curtain and fastened with brads. I wonder "Hoo" will get this card....
